Driveway Slab Replacement Costs
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,000 - $8,500 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Standard driveway slab replacement |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full driveway overhaul | $4,000 - $8,500 |
| Crack repair and resurfacing | $1,500 - $3,200 |
| Reinforced concrete slab | $2,200 - $4,500 |
| Stamped or decorative finish | $3,500 - $8,000 |
| Slope correction or leveling | $2,000 - $5,000 |

Driveway slab replacement in North Las Vegas, NV, involves removing and replacing existing concrete slabs to restore functionality and appearance. This project can vary depending on materials, scope, and local requirements. Understanding typical considerations can help in planning and comparison.
- Materials: Common options include standard concrete, stamped concrete, or reinforced slabs,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for North Las Vegas conditions.
- Size and Scope: Projects may range from small residential driveways to larger commercial areas, affecting overall complexity and material quantities.
- Labor Complexity: Removal of existing slabs, excavation, and proper sub-base preparation are key steps that influence labor requirements and project duration.
- Permitting: Local regulations in North Las Vegas may necessitate permits for driveway modifications, especially for larger or structural changes.
- Additional Options: Upgrades such as decorative finishes, expansion joints, or drainage improvements can be included as extras to enhance functionality and appearance.
Determining the scope based on driveway dimensions and complexity.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small driveway (single-car) |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Medium driveway (two-car) |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Large driveway (three or more cars) | $8,000 - $12,000 |
| Full replacement with reinforcement | $10,000 - $15,000 |
| Minor repairs (patching/cracks) | $500 - $1,500 |
